43. Samhain: Halloween Traditions & Tales

The veil is thinning and soon Samhain, the scariest night of the year, will be upon us. But what is it that makes this night, the 31st of October, just so spooky? In this episode Jenny explores the ancient celtic roots of Samhain, traditional protective rituals, divination games,  and tells the tale of a lass who decided to peak behind the veil to find out who her future husband would be.
